* Make local.tee's type its local's type (#2511)Heejin Ahn2019-12-121-4/+5
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| According to the current spec, `local.tee`'s return type should be the same as its local's type. (Discussions on whether we should change this rule is going on in WebAssembly/reference-types#55, but here I will assume this spec does not change. If this changes, we should change many parts of Binaryen transformation anyway...) But currently in Binaryen `local.tee`'s type is computed from its value's type. This didn't make any difference in the MVP, but after we have subtype relationship in #2451, this can become a problem. For example: ``` (func $test (result funcref) (local $0 anyref) (local.tee $0 (ref.func $test) ) ) ``` This shouldn't validate in the spec, but this will pass Binaryen validation with the current `local.tee` implementation. This makes `local.tee`'s type computed from the local's type, and makes `LocalSet::makeTee` get a type parameter, to which we should pass the its corresponding local's type. We don't embed the local type in the class `LocalSet` because it may increase memory size. This also fixes the type of `local.get` to be the local type where `local.get` and `local.set` pair is created from `local.tee`.

* Speculate in simplify-locals that it is worth turning an if intoAlon Zakai (kripken)2018-12-041-27/+95
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| an if-else. If an if sets a local, (if (..condition..) (set_local $x (..value..)) ) we can turn it into (set_local $x (if (..condition..) (..value..) (get_local $x) ) ) This increases code size and adds a branch in the if, but allows the set to be optimized into a tee or optimized out entirely. In the worst case, other optimizations can break up an if with a copy in one of its arms later. Includes a determinism fix for EquivalentSets, which this patch triggered.

* Optimize equivalent locals (#1540)Alon Zakai2018-05-101-72/+205
| | | | | | | | | If locals are known to contain the same value, we can * Pick which local to use for a get_local of any of them. Makes sense to prefer the most common, to increase the chance of one dropping to zero uses. * Remove copies between a local and one that we know contains the same value. This is a consistent win, small though, around 0.1-0.2%.
